Hemp Seeds For Growing If you search "hemp seeds" into Google, you're going to find two different sort of results. Nutritional hemp seeds (offered around the world) and hemp seeds intended for growing hemp plants in your home. Nutritional hemp seeds have been processed generally having their external shell eliminated and roasted. These seeds are rendered sterile from this process and can not be used for growing.

These seeds are sold in packages consisting of countless specific seeds. Hemp seeds meant for growing have not been treated and will sprout into a living plant if exposed to the best conditions. These are normally more pricey and consist of anywhere from a single seed to a couple of lots seeds.

Autoflower seeds are reproduced to start blooming by themselves timeline, irrelevant of the day length cycles. These pressures are much better for people who either don't live in a climate conducive to matching the day lengths required for marijuana to flower or those who lack the capability to control the day cycles artificially (aka, a dedicated growing environment).

Autoflower seeds are created by integrating Cannabis sativa or Marijuana indica with another species called Marijuana ruderalis, which naturally has this autoflower quality. What are clones? A clone is a genetically identical copy of a plant. Plants have the capability to distinguish any tissue. This implies it can turn leaf cells into root cells if it requires to. Growers can cut sections of stems and leaves from mature plants and require them to grow roots spontaneously.

This is a typical strategy growers utilize to expand their stock. As long as the initial plant is female, every clone that comes from it will likewise be female and have the exact very same development rates. Buying clones is a fast and simple way to make sure you're always utilizing female plants, without needing to take the time to weed out the male plants from the stock.
